## Deploying the Gatewick Proctor Queue

Deploys are pretty painless: push to main, wait for the pipeline, then watch the queue drain dashboard for five minutes. If candidates pile up mid-exam, roll back first and ask questions later — the queue replays safely. Everything the workers care about lives in one config block, shown here for reference.

settings of bafof-yagef:
JOROX_PIN=8740
JOROX_TENANT=pelox
JOROX_METRICS_HOST=metrics.jorox.qorvelworks.internal
JOROX_SEAL=seal_c78f63c1
JOROX_STANDBY_TEAM=norax

Subject: DR drill notes — Cartwheel checkout load test

Hey future maintainers — quick recap from Friday's disaster-recovery drill. We replayed peak checkout traffic against the standby region and the flow held up fine until the payment stub's secrets cache expired. Re-arming it is manual, sorry. When the loadgen console asks you to unlock the stub, use the recovery passphrase below.

recovery phrase for fawif-tajeg: norael-aldmir-casir-brivan-ulaion

Onboarding note for support: all SQL files in the Querystone repo pass through our linter before merge. Rules to know when reading tickets: uppercase keywords, explicit column lists (no SELECT *), and mandatory comments on any migration touching customer tables. If a customer reports a failed schema push, check the lint report first — most failures are formatting, not logic. To verify signed migration bundles when escalating, you will need the current signing key, shown below.

signing key of bagap-yawep = bky13_TbfT6ZMUoGJo2

## Timezone Handling in Exports — Reviewer Notes

All Tallgrain report exports are generated in UTC and converted at render time using the tenant's stored offset. Auditing the conversion service requires unlocking the export sandbox, which is gated by a shared recovery passphrase rotated monthly. The current value for this review cycle is given below.

recovery phrase for hahof-yajop: olimir-ulador